Delivered to the Schweizer Flugwaffe on 8 November 1966. It was repainted and modified with canards in 1991. J-2311 was the "gold" goodbye Swiss Mirage 3S at Buochs-Ennetbürgen to symbolize the golden era. The aircraft was stored from March 2000 at Buochs and eventually scrapped at Stans.

Delivered to the Flugwaffe on 12 June 1969, nicknamed 'Mata-hari' (see nose section). The rercce Mirage was modified with canards in March 1991 and acted for this modification as a testbed at Bordeaux-Merignac (France). The Mirage made its last flight on 17 December 2003 and was stored at Buochs up to 2007. It was then preserved at the Flieger-Flab-Museum at Dübendorf.

Former RAF WW589 was delivered to the Flugwaffe on 13 April 1973. The Hunter, here seen assigned to Fliegerstaffel 1, was sadly written off in a crash near the Nufenenpass (Switzerland) on 20 October 1989.

Accepted by the Swiss Air Force on 13 May 1966. The Mirage was later modified with canards and with a new grey color scheme. J-2306 was one of the four very last Mirage 3S's (together with J-2303, J-2308 and J-2332) of the Flugwaffe that made their last operational flight on 2 December 1999. It was then retired and stored at Buochs-Ennetbürgen. The cockpit section of this J-2306 survived and can be seen at the Flieger-Flab-Museum at Dübendorf.

This Eagle started factory fresh its USAF career at Soesterberg air base on 7 July 1980. It was transferred to the 57th Fighter Interceptor Squadron at Keflavik (Iceland) on 25 September 1992. It stayed there up to February 1995. The Eagle moved to the 325th Fighter Wing at Tyndal AFB (FL) and eventually from June 2010 to the massive storage depot at Davis Monthan (AZ). As 'Rambo04', the pilot of this 79-0021 - then assigned to the 525th TFS / 36th TFW at Bitburg, shot down an Iraqi Mirage F1EQ with AIM-7 air to air missile on 19 January 1991.

This weird looking aircraft was built by Eidgenoessische Konstruktionswerkstaette (EKW) as C3603, delivered to the Flugwaffe on 14 April 1944 and modified to C3605-standard (the original 12 cylinder engine was replaced by a turbo prop) in 1971. The aircraft, seen here serving the Zielfliegerkorps (glider corps) was withdrawn from use on 15 July 1987. It was offered for sale later that year and seen engineless with the Jordacier-factory in Bex (Switserland) in late 1988.

This Hunter was delivered to Switzerland on 6 April 1960. It was used by K-Rep for battle damage repair training at Interlaken after it was withdrawn from active service on 25 November 1994. The aircraft was scrapped at Interlaken but its cockpit section survived. This section is used as travelling display for the Flugwaffe,

Delivered to Switzerland as part of the US Foreign Military Sales program with serial 76-1550. The Tiger was assembled at Emmen and delivered to the Schweizer Luftwaffe on 19 October 1979. J-3025 was the last of the 32 former Swiss aircraft (first badge) delivered from Emmen by an US Navy C-130 to the US Navy on 13 November 2007. The Tiger was modified to F-5N and continued to fly as an adversary aircraft with BuNo 761550.

Delivered to the Flugwaffe as part of the US Foreign Military Sales program with serial 76-1551. The Tiger was assembled at Emmen and accepted by the Swiss on 31 October 1979. It was noted withdrawn from use at Meiringen in 2000. After a storage period, the Tiger was sold to the US Navy, modified to F-5N, and started to serve as an adversary aircraft with BuNo 761551 by May 2004.
